Abstract

A vehicle includes an integrated floor and traction battery support assembly. The assembly includes a floor panel and cross-members each having an upper portion attached to a lower surface of the floor panel and extending laterally across the floor panel. The assembly further includes a battery tray attached to lower portions of the cross-members and cooperating with the lower surface to define a battery-pack enclosure. A battery pack is disposed in the enclosure.
